BOV M11 is a vehicle specialized for reconnaissance. This armored vehicle was produced in the factory "Složeni Borbeni Sistemi", Velika Plana, Serbia. BOV M11 has a main role as a reconnaissance vehicle and a command-reconnaissance vehicle. If used in artillery, it can be used for observation and to direct fire.
